Mitchell Park Juniors takes on the world again in 2012

07th February 2012

This year looks likely to be a hotly contested year as three of our young high achievers are set to take on the world again this year.

Scott, Jonny and Rebecca will travel to Australia in April this year to compete in the Aussie Junior series.

Scott and possibly Jonny and Rebecca will then travel to Malaysia in May/June to compete the Penang Junior open and the Milo All star championship in Kuala Lumpur

Jonny and possibly Scott (as an individual) will travel to the World Junior Boys championships

Scott will then travel Northern Territories in September to contest the Australian U15 nationals title where he came 3rd in 2011.

Scott will then travel to the UK in December 2012 to play in the Scottish and British Junior opens.

Mitchell Park Juniors takes on the world

Three Mitchell Park Juniors are set to take on the world in 2011

Three of our own outstanding Juniors are to take on the world in 2011.

SCOTT GALLOWAY just returned from the UK where he contested the Scottish and British Junior opens.

Scott is only twelve and competed in the U13 divisions at both tournaments.

At the Scottish Junior Open he took gold, winning the U13 division without loosing a game and only conceeding 19 points for the whole tournament.

At the British Scott managed to reach the semi finals after beating the 4th seed in 5. Scott achieved a 4th placing over all and now ranks 4th in the world for the U13s

Scott intends travelling to Australia in April and Malaysia in June to attempt winning the U15 divisions at these tournaments. Scott is 12 and a B1 player.

REBECCA BARNETT has been selected to play in the Junior world champs this year and has been training hard in the NZ elite team. Rebecca is 17 and an A grade player.

JONATHAN BARNETT has been selected to play in the Junior world champs NEXT year and has been selected for the NZ elite team for 2011. Jonny is 17 and an A grade player.
